#!/bin/bash
# DeBros Network Production Installation Script
# Installs and configures a complete DeBros network node (bootstrap) with gateway.
# Supports idempotent updates and secure systemd service management.
set -e
trap 'echo -e "${RED}An error occurred. Installation aborted.${NOCOLOR}"; exit 1' ERR
# Color codes
RED='\033[0;31m'
GREEN='\033[0;32m'
CYAN='\033[0;36m'
BLUE='\033[38;2;2;128;175m'
YELLOW='\033[1;33m'
NOCOLOR='\033[0m'
# REQUIRE INTERACTIVE MODE - This script must be run in a terminal
if [ ! -t 0 ]; then
echo -e "${RED}[ERROR]${NOCOLOR} This script requires an interactive terminal."
echo -e ""
echo -e "${YELLOW}Please run this script directly in a terminal:${NOCOLOR}"
echo -e "${CYAN} sudo bash scripts/install-debros-network.sh${NOCOLOR}"
echo -e ""
echo -e "${YELLOW}Do NOT pipe this script:${NOCOLOR}"
echo -e "${RED} curl ... | bash${NOCOLOR} ← This will NOT work"
echo -e ""
exit 1
fi

check_go_installation() {
if command -v go &> /dev/null; then
GO_VERSION=$(go version | awk '{print $3}' | sed 's/go//')
log "Found Go version: $GO_VERSION"
if [ "$(printf '%s\n' "$MIN_GO_VERSION" "$GO_VERSION" | sort -V | head -n1)" = "$MIN_GO_VERSION" ]; then
success "Go version is sufficient"
return 0
else
warning "Go version $GO_VERSION is too old. Minimum required: $MIN_GO_VERSION"
return 1
fi
else
log "Go not found on system"
return 1
fi
}

install_rqlite() {
if command -v rqlited &> /dev/null; then
RQLITE_VERSION=$(rqlited -version | head -n1 | awk '{print $2}')
log "Found RQLite version: $RQLITE_VERSION"
success "RQLite already installed"
return 0
fi
log "Installing RQLite..."
ARCH=$(uname -m)
case $ARCH in
x86_64) RQLITE_ARCH="amd64" ;;
aarch64|arm64) RQLITE_ARCH="arm64" ;;
armv7l) RQLITE_ARCH="arm" ;;
*) error "Unsupported architecture: $ARCH"; exit 1 ;;
esac
RQLITE_VERSION="8.43.0"
RQLITE_TARBALL="rqlite-v${RQLITE_VERSION}-linux-${RQLITE_ARCH}.tar.gz"
RQLITE_URL="https://github.com/rqlite/rqlite/releases/download/v${RQLITE_VERSION}/${RQLITE_TARBALL}"
cd /tmp
if ! wget -q "$RQLITE_URL"; then error "Failed to download RQLite from $RQLITE_URL"; exit 1; fi
tar -xzf "$RQLITE_TARBALL"
RQLITE_DIR="rqlite-v${RQLITE_VERSION}-linux-${RQLITE_ARCH}"
sudo cp "$RQLITE_DIR/rqlited" /usr/local/bin/
sudo cp "$RQLITE_DIR/rqlite" /usr/local/bin/
sudo chmod +x /usr/local/bin/rqlited
sudo chmod +x /usr/local/bin/rqlite
rm -rf "$RQLITE_TARBALL" "$RQLITE_DIR"
if command -v rqlited &> /dev/null; then
INSTALLED_VERSION=$(rqlited -version | head -n1 | awk '{print $2}')
success "RQLite v$INSTALLED_VERSION installed successfully"
else
error "RQLite installation failed"
exit 1
fi
}

create_systemd_services() {
log "Creating systemd service units..."
# Node service
local node_service_file="/etc/systemd/system/debros-node.service"
if [ -f "$node_service_file" ]; then
log "Cleaning up existing node service..."
sudo systemctl stop debros-node.service 2>/dev/null || true
sudo systemctl disable debros-node.service 2>/dev/null || true
sudo rm -f "$node_service_file"
fi
sudo systemctl daemon-reload
log "Creating new systemd service..."
local exec_start="$INSTALL_DIR/bin/node --config $INSTALL_DIR/configs/node.yaml"
cat > /tmp/debros-node.service << EOF
[Unit]
Description=DeBros Network Node (Bootstrap)
After=network-online.target
Wants=network-online.target
[Service]
Type=simple
User=debros
Group=debros
WorkingDirectory=$INSTALL_DIR/src
ExecStart=$INSTALL_DIR/bin/node --config bootstrap.yaml
Restart=always
RestartSec=5
StandardOutput=journal
StandardError=journal
SyslogIdentifier=debros-node
NoNewPrivileges=yes
PrivateTmp=yes
ProtectSystem=strict
ReadWritePaths=$INSTALL_DIR
[Install]
WantedBy=multi-user.target
EOF
sudo mv /tmp/debros-node.service "$node_service_file"
# Gateway service
local gateway_service_file="/etc/systemd/system/debros-gateway.service"
if [ -f "$gateway_service_file" ]; then
log "Cleaning up existing gateway service..."
sudo systemctl stop debros-gateway.service 2>/dev/null || true
sudo systemctl disable debros-gateway.service 2>/dev/null || true
sudo rm -f "$gateway_service_file"
fi
log "Creating debros-gateway.service..."
cat > /tmp/debros-gateway.service << EOF
[Unit]
Description=DeBros Gateway (HTTP/WebSocket)
After=debros-node.service
Wants=debros-node.service
[Service]
Type=simple
User=debros
Group=debros
WorkingDirectory=$INSTALL_DIR/src
ExecStart=$INSTALL_DIR/bin/gateway
Restart=always
RestartSec=5
StandardOutput=journal
StandardError=journal
SyslogIdentifier=debros-gateway
NoNewPrivileges=yes
PrivateTmp=yes
ProtectSystem=strict
ReadWritePaths=$INSTALL_DIR
[Install]
WantedBy=multi-user.target
EOF
sudo mv /tmp/debros-gateway.service "$gateway_service_file"
sudo systemctl daemon-reload
sudo systemctl enable debros-node.service
sudo systemctl enable debros-gateway.service
success "Systemd services ready"
}
